Autorité Des Marchés Financiers Appoints Martine Charbonnier And Guillaume Eliet As Managing Directors

Date 16/01/2013

Martine Charbonnier has been appointed Managing Director of the Corporate Finance Directorate and the Corporate Accounting and Auditing Directorate, effective 14 January 2013. Guillaume Eliet has been promoted to Managing Director of the Asset Management Directorate. Guillaume will remain as head of the Asset Management Directorate, a post he has held since 2010. Both will join the AMF’s executive committee.

Martine Charbonnier has been appointed Managing Director of the Corporate Finance Directorate and the Corporate Accounting and Auditing Directorate, effective 14 January 2013

Martine Charbonnier, 54, is a specialist in securities markets and listings. In the course of her career she has been involved in numerous initial public offerings and corporate finance transactions, and has managed teams at international level.

Martine began her career in 1982 as an investment analyst at Fidal. She then moved to SBF - Bourse de Paris, where she worked for 16 years successively as an investment analyst, head of the IPO department, Deputy Director in charge of corporate finance and issuers relations. In 2000, following the merger of several European stock exchanges, she was named Executive Director of Listing and Issuers at Euronext NV. In

2007 she became Executive Vice-President in charge of the Listing Europe business unit at NYSE Euronext. In 2009 she joined Oddo Corporate Finance as a partner. Since 2011 she has served as an independent director and audit committee member for several listed groups. Martine is a graduate of ESC Dijon Bourgogne and Société Française des Analystes Financiers.

Guillaume Eliet has been promoted to Managing Director of the Asset Management Directorate

Guillaume Eliet, 41, worked at Caisse des Dépôts et Consignations and then joined BNP as a lawyer on the bond trading floor. In 1999 he moved to the law firm Coudert Brothers LLP. He joined the Autorité des Marchés Financiers in May 2005 as a legal expert in charge of policy at the Investment Service Providers and Products Department, and in 2009 became deputy head of that department. Since 2010 he has served as head of the Asset Management Directorate, and will stay on in that function as Managing Director. A qualified lawyer, Guillaume holds a postgraduate diploma in business and tax law and a Magistère degree in business law from Sorbonne-Paris I University.
